Output 3bb4a2da41ae0099edd8ac468a556aa176d59eb56a605baa29af7d396569fe53:0

value
2650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 352f32b2bda70871abf3bb2904141c2fa74a652d OP_EQUALVERIFY OP_CHECKSIG
address
15rDMYa58LgXrboQmWpjAh4TLvCqiLA4G1
transaction
3bb4a2da41ae0099edd8ac468a556aa176d59eb56a605baa29af7d396569fe53
spent
true